      Here's something that I've been working on for a LONG TIME, and I think I'm finally finished...

      It's a 1970 Honda CT70 mini trail bike. I had one of these when I was young, and sure wish that I had never sold it!

      They were produced from 1969 to 1981 and had a wheelbase of about 41 inches and a 4.5 hp engine with a top speed of about 40 mph...these bikes were meant to be used for recreational trail riding.

      They had a 3 speed transmission with a centrifugal clutch - all you had to do was back off on the throttle and shift. Since there was no clutch, the left lever was actually a brake lever, which was a bit of a learning curve for someone not used to it (and fun to watch).

      The first two images are Kerkythea renders, and the rest are SketchUp.
